    Fleabags.net-1.0

    Open-Source Centos7 project to offer rapid communication apps.

    The purpose of this project is to provide centralized and secure open-source communication applications on Centos7. Most services (Wiki, Email, XMPP/Jabber) are connected to OpenLDAP which can be managed through a Webmin console on port https/10000. This makes it easier to stay secure as passwords can be changed on the fly through the Webmin console interface with minor reconfiguration for your domain.

    LDAP Users Admin is a Webmin module for those who use LDAP directories (like OpenLDAP) for user account information or as an e-mail address book. It'll take care of common tasks such as getting an unused UID, editting address book fields and the like.
